Background & Context

The baobab tree (Adansonia digitata) is an iconic symbol of the African savanna, known for its majestic size and long lifespan, often reaching thousands of years. Indigenous to Africa, particularly prominent in countries like Kenya and Tanzania, the fruit of this remarkable tree has been a staple in traditional diets and medicine for centuries. It's not just a food source; it’s a cultural cornerstone, providing sustenance and healing properties across generations.
What makes baobab so special? It’s its unparalleled nutritional profile. The fruit pulp, which naturally dries inside its shell, is an extraordinary source of essential nutrients. According to Healthline, baobab fruit can supply you with significant amounts of vitamins and minerals, helping to reduce inflammation and balance blood sugar levels Healthline. Research indicates that baobab contains up to 10 times the Vitamin C of oranges, making it a potent immune booster Aduna Superfoods. It's also an excellent source of dietary fiber, calcium, potassium, magnesium, and antioxidants.

Enhance Digestive Health and Weight Management
Baobab is a phenomenal source of dietary fiber, both soluble and insoluble. This fiber plays a crucial role in maintaining a healthy digestive system, preventing constipation, and promoting regular bowel movements. The soluble fiber in baobab acts as a prebiotic, feeding beneficial gut bacteria, which is essential for gut health. This can also aid in weight loss by promoting feelings of fullness and reducing appetite, thereby supporting healthy eating habits. Regulate Blood Sugar Levels
The high fiber content of baobab fruit also contributes to its ability to help stabilize blood sugar levels. Fiber slows down the absorption of sugar into the bloodstream, preventing rapid spikes and crashes. Combat Inflammation and Oxidative Stress
Baobab is packed with polyphenols and other antioxidants that actively combat oxidative stress and reduce inflammation throughout the body. Chronic inflammation is linked to various health issues, making baobab a valuable food for protective health. A rat study highlighted in Healthline found that baobab fruit pulp reduced multiple markers of inflammation and helped protect the heart from damage Healthline. This anti-inflammatory action is crucial for overall cellular health.

Common Mistakes to Avoid
While baobab fruit offers numerous benefits, it's important to use it wisely and avoid common pitfalls. One frequent mistake is expecting baobab to be a magic bullet. While it's a superfood, it works best as part of a balanced diet and healthy lifestyle, not as a replacement for essential nutrients or medical treatments. Another error is consuming excessive amounts, particularly of baobab fruit powder. Although natural, too much fiber can lead to digestive discomfort like bloating or gas. Always start with smaller doses and gradually increase.
Furthermore, overlooking the source and quality of your baobab product is a common oversight. Opt for organic, sustainably sourced baobab powder to ensure you are getting a pure, potent product free from contaminants. Always check for certifications. Be mindful of potential interactions if you are on medication; consulting a healthcare professional is always recommended, especially if you have underlying health conditions. Q1: What exactly is baobab fruit powder?
A: Baobab fruit powder is made from the naturally dried pulp of the baobab fruit. Unlike most fruits, the baobab fruit dries completely while still on the branch, forming a powdery substance inside its hard shell. This powder is then harvested and milled, retaining all its impressive nutrients, making it ready for various baobab fruit powder uses.

Q4: Are there any side effects of consuming baobab?
A: Baobab is generally considered safe for consumption. However, due to its high fiber content, excessive intake might lead to mild digestive discomfort such as bloating or gas, especially if your body isn't accustomed to a fiber-rich diet. Start with small amounts and increase gradually. Consult a healthcare professional if you have concerns or existing conditions.
